The Orphan The Poet
Based out of Columbus, Ohio, alt-rock duo THE ORPHAN THE POET is catching eyes and ears well-beyond their midwest roots, thanks to their electric live show and singalong hooks. The band has made waves all over the country, appearing on festival bills like Firefly Music Festival, Riotfest, and Summerfest and garnering the attention of SiriusXM’s Alt Nation, KROQ in Los Angeles, and BBC’s Radio1.
The band kicked off 2022 with the release of their single “Feelin’ Good (Could Be Better)”, which was co-written / co-produced with close-collaborator, Matt Squire (Ariana Grande, Panic! at the Disco, Demi Lovato). The track has already made it’s way to SiriusXM’s Alt Nation, Apple Music’s Alternative Workout, Spotify’s It’s ALT Good, and sync’d for use on FOX Sports during college football season.
The duo found themselves opening for The Driver Era and alt-radio favorites Weathers across the country, as well as making festival appearances on the WonderBus + Wonderstruck lineups alongside Lorde, Vampire Weekend, and others. With more releases on the way, THE ORPHAN THE POET is setting the stage for their biggest year yet.
